show me the money

posted by Brent Finnegan

The other day, Waldo pointed out on his blog that VPAP now has a feature where you can tell where political campaign contributions come from, geographically speaking. Interestingly, it looks like the largest contributions by locality for Obenshain came from Harrisonburg and Rockingham, while the largest contributions for Lohr by locality came from Richmond.
